Fushimi Inari

Fushimi Inari is located in Fushimi-ku, Kyoto-shi and the about 40,000 whole country lets it be a head temple in a certain Inari.

An empty space is found at last and it passes through the head temple in national Inari Taisha, and the gate in Fushimi Inari still more. If a car is parked in a parking lot, the torii which is in left-hand first will turn into the second torii. A two-storied gate appears suddenly from here. In the two-storied gate, the image of the Minister of the Right and the Minister of the Left is installed. If it passes through a two-storied gate, Gehaiden will appear in the front next. Naihaiden is in the left back and the main shrine of Fushimi Inari Taisha Shrine of an important cultural property comes out by Naihaiden and ridge continuation. When a shrine office front is progressed looking at a main shrine to the right hand, there is stone-made torii, and the approach called 10000 shrine gates of Fushimi Inari begins from here still more. 1000 books are actually impossible for the number of a certain torii, and, probably there are likely to be tens of thousands of. The tunnel of lengthy torii will continue to Itinomine which is in the Inari mountain (altitude of 233m) summit of the mountain from here. If it passes over Okumiya and goes up first, the torii first divided into two forks can be seen. It will pass along the inside of left-hand side torii by left-hand side one-way traffic. In the section here, probably, the implications which avoid confusion also have torii, since it is comparatively narrow. And a stone called an Omokaru stone is shown in an inner shrine worship place and here, and if the stone prayed [ for ] to God and lifted is light than expected, it is supposed that the wish suits coming out. If it passes through torii again from here and goes a worship way, ascent will become sudden still more from per Mitsutsuji and hereabouts. If it reaches for a while, there is Yotsutsuji. The good view of a view can be enjoyed from Yotsutsuji. Then, although Sannomine comes out, upper Ninomine is continuation of the hardest part and steep stairs further from here.
